### Step 4: Migrate the Tidemark Widget

Before cutting over, verify the tide-table widget on Gullhaven's status page points at the new prediction service. The legacy feed shuts off at the end of the maintenance window, so any stale endpoint will render empty tables for coastal users. Update the widget service first, restart, then confirm tide heights render for at least two stations. Apply the following configuration values to the widget service.

service settings:
[oliix]
team = noveth
access_code = ac_4de949
host = oliix.novachq.corp
port = 8080
owner = wenir.casion
peer = wenys.lumicstack.corp

Handover — LiftLogic Simulator

Welcome aboard. The dispatch simulator lives in the liftlogic-core repo; the scheduler models hall calls against car positions every 200ms tick. Config is in sim.yaml — don't touch the peak-traffic weights until the Marbury Tower scenario passes. Nightly runs push results to the metrics share. Access to the encrypted scenario archive requires the maintainer keyring. If the keyring is lost, restore it with the passphrase below.

recovery phrase for tagug-yagug: lamox-gilax-keleth-gilath

## Runbook: Deep-Link Routing Rollout (Wayfinder)

Before shipping the Wayfinder routing update, confirm that the link-map manifest compiles against both the Lanternmoss iOS shell and the Android shell, since stale manifests silently fall back to the web view. Stage the manifest behind the `wf_routes_v2` flag, verify the ten canonical paths in the smoke matrix, and hold for Tilda's sign-off at the eng sync. Once approved, the manifest bundle must be signed prior to CDN upload, and signing is performed with the key that follows.

signing key of baduf-taweg = bky6_Zf7bem

For the security review of Sketchline's undo/redo stack: history entries now store serialized diffs rather than full document snapshots, which shrinks the attack surface for memory exhaustion but adds deserialization on redo. Diffs are validated against the schema before replay. History depth and entry size are bounded to prevent abuse. The enforced limits are configured as follows.

limits module of tafop-hahop:
WEIGHTS = {
    "julmir": 223,
    "belox": 987,
    "lamion": 470,
    "pelath": 609,
    "fraok": 1010,
    "eliion": 343,
    "drudor": 342,
}